Product: HP Envy x360 14 inch 2-in-1 Laptop PC 14-fa-0000 (8Z8P7AV)
Operating System: Microsoft Windows 11
Can someone provide step-by-step instructions to properly SECURE ERASE the SSD on this laptop for resale? BIOS does not provide the option. I see there may be some paid tools out there but it seems this should be a free option within HP BIOS or other to complete. I don't want to complete a Windows 11 re-install, as that does not properly wipe the whole SSD drive securely.
